[Percutaneous transcatheter closure of ventricular septal defects using an Amplatz device]

Insights

Percutaneous closure of ventricular septal defects using the Amplatz device proved effective in 12 of 15 patients, with no complications and sustained symptom-free outcomes. This minimally invasive technique offers a promising option for treating these heart conditions.

Context:

  • Ventricular septal defects (VSDs) are common congenital heart abnormalities.
  • Percutaneous closure offers a less invasive alternative to surgical repair.
  • The Amplatz device is a novel option for VSD closure.

Purpose:

  • To evaluate the initial experience and safety of using the Amplatz device for percutaneous VSD closure.
  • To assess the efficacy and outcomes of Amplatz device implantation in a diverse patient group.
  • To analyze the procedural success and complication rates associated with this technique.

Summary:

  • Fifteen patients (ages 1-44) with VSDs (muscular and perimembranous) underwent attempted percutaneous closure with an Amplatz device.
  • Successful implantation was achieved in 12 patients, with 11 experiencing immediate complete closure.
  • No immediate or follow-up complications were reported; all successfully treated patients remained asymptomatic with complete closure confirmed by echocardiography.

Impact:

  • Demonstrates the feasibility and safety of Amplatz device use for VSD closure.
  • Highlights the potential for a minimally invasive treatment option for VSD patients.
  • Provides early clinical data supporting the efficacy of percutaneous VSD closure with this device.
